About the Competitive CX Hosts
Hamish Taylor is a world leader in Customer-led Transformations. A multi-award winning CEO, his career has taken him from Brand Management at Procter and Gamble, Consultancy at PWC and Head of Brands at BA to become CEO of channel tunnel railway Eurostar and CEO of Sainsbury’s Bank – all before he was 40. In each case he left a record of significant growth by challenging the established way of operating and, in particular, by enabling the organisation to place its customers at the core of all activities. More recently, he has taken his “Customer-led Transformation” approach to hundreds of organisations and teams in 48 different countries. He has also been dubbed the “MasterThief” for his ability to take ideas from one industry or discipline to another.
Melanie Aimer
Melanie has over 20 years of financial services experience spanning Capital Markets, Corporate & Investment Banking, Asset Management, Private Bank & Wealth Management with Citibank, BNP Paribas and Barclays. With her vast multinational corporate Board and Exco level experience, Melanie has an award-winning record of delivering innovative client transformation across the full client and customer value-chain delivering best-in-class services in complex global organizations in a cost-effective agile manner and simplifying front to back processes spanning across people, marketing, data, and digital.
